Caron Treatment Centers

Caron Treatment Centers is an addiction treatment facility at 401 Plymouth Road, Suite 325 in Plymouth Meeting, Pennsylvania, offering partial hospitalization or residential treatment, outpatient treatment, and medication-assisted treatment, according to its SAMHSA FindTreatment.gov listing as of April 10, 2026. The same record also lists opioid treatment medications. Payment options listed in the record include Cash or self-payment and Private health insurance. The directory lists 484-342-5750 as the facility's phone number. All details on this page come from that federal record and should be confirmed directly with the facility.
